Linseed has a high content of:
-Vitamins and minerals, including most of the B vitamins, magnesium and manganese.
-Fibers, soluble and insoluble.
-Phytochemicals, including many powerful antioxidants, such as lignans. In fact, because it is a plant, Linseed is one of the best sources of lignans.
-Ω-3 fatty acids, the key to fighting inflammation. Linseed is a better source of plant omega-3 called α-linolenic acid (ALA). Linseed oil - consists of about 50% ALA - five times more than walnut oil or canola oil, which are the next highest sources of ALA.
Linseed can:
-Reduce blood cholesterol and blood sugar levels. The soluble fiber in Linseed has been shown to lower cholesterol, helping to prevent the formation of atherosclerotic plaque, which can clog arteries and lead to high blood pressure, stroke or heart attack. Fiber is also thought to lower blood sugar levels, which is important for people with type 2 diabetes.
-To reduce bone loss. A study in diabetic mice showed that there was a slowdown in bone loss after a Linseed diet, thanks to the concentration of fatty acids.
-Help in weight management. Linseed expands when ingested, making you feel full. So by consuming Linseed 30 minutes before your meal you can control your appetite.
-Improve the health of the digestive system. The fiber in Linseed can relieve constipation.
-Increase immunity. ALA has been shown to reduce inflammation, making the immune system work better. Recent research shows that Linseed can help treat autoimmune and inflammatory di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is, psoriasis and lupus.
-Help in the fight against cancer. Studies have shown that Linseed plays an important role in the fight against cancer, especially of the colon and breast. The benefit is based on its high content of lignans, which are believed to inhibit tumor growth.

Caution:
People with inflammatory bowel disease, such as Crohn's disease, should avoid Linseed in large quantities because of its laxative properties. Also, pregnant and breastfeeding mothers should not consume Linseed. Studies also show that women with fibroids, endometriosis and polycystic ovary syndrome should not consume Linseed. Men at increased risk for prostate cancer should avoid sources of ALA. If you are taking medication, ask your doctor before adding Linseed to your diet.
